Vivek Shraya

Author
Publisher
ECW Press
Language
English
Description
Author
Publisher
Arsenal Pulp Press
Pub. Date
2019
Language
English
Description
Author
Publisher
Arsenal Pulp Press
Pub. Date
2016
Language
English
Description